Abstract
The implementation of GIS based application is growing
rapidly in many areas such as business, government, or public
services. Potential implementation of a GIS-based application
then applied to the mapping of conditions and irrigation
building and canal. The application will display the latest
information on the condition of each building irrigation in
Rentang area, covering three districts namely Majalengka,
Cirebon and Indramayu. This area has about 1000 buildings
irrigation and segment that connects between buildings. In
order to present the interactive map and running in a web
environment, the map should be processed using a series of
stages of preparation of maps using GIS software such as
ArcGIS, Quantum GIS, PosgreSQL and PostGIS, GeoServer,
and OpenLayers. The resulting map is then divided into three
main layers based on category object to be displayed, that is
the main irrigation channel, secondary channel and tapping
buildings. Users can see the position and condition of each
object which is represented by a different color for each
condition: green for good conditions, yellow for minor
damage and red for major damage. This application is
expected to help the units involved in obtaining a general
overview of irrigation in certain areas quickly and accurately
